6XA0

Crystal structure of C-As lyase with mutation K105R with Ni(II)

Summary for 6XA0
Entry DOI10.2210/pdb6xa0/pdb
DescriptorGlyoxalase/bleomycin resistance protein/dioxygenase, NICKEL (II) ION (3 entities in total)
Functional Keywordsc-as lyase, oxidoreductase
Biological sourceThermomonospora curvata (strain ATCC 19995 / DSM 43183 / JCM 3096 / NBRC 15933 / NCIMB 10081 / Henssen B9)
Total number of polymer chains2
Total formula weight27079.58
Authors
Venkadesh, S.,Yoshinaga, M.,Kandavelu, P.,Sankaran, B.,Rosen, B.P. (deposition date: 2020-06-03, release date: 2021-06-09, Last modification date: 2023-10-18)
Primary citationNadar, V.S.,Kandavelu, P.,Sankaran, B.,Rosen, B.P.,Yoshinaga, M.
The ArsI C-As lyase: Elucidating the catalytic mechanism of degradation of organoarsenicals.
J.Inorg.Biochem., 232:111836-111836, 2022
